What do you need to know about 220v LED TVs?

The screen

The biggest determining factor of 220v LED TVs is, of course, their LED screens. Light-emitting diodes (LEDs) are semiconductor devices that produce light whenever an electric current passes through.

You’ll see LED screens almost everywhere—including smartphones, laptops, and computer monitors. However, 220 volt TVs in the USA are their most popular applications.

Features

High-definition LED screens aren’t the only great thing about 220-volt TVs in the USA. They come with loads of amazing features such as wireless connectivity and surround sound. Leading brands even manufacture televisions with smart connectivity, perfect for streaming online platforms like Netflix and Amazon Prime.

State-of-the-art LED TVs also come with motion rate technology to reduce blur when you’re watching action-packed movie scenes. Additionally, they’re equipped with multiple ports for connecting flash drives, HDMI cables, and ethernet cables.

Benefits

Did you know that LED TVs generally consume 20% to 30% less power than other types? Unlike 110-220 volts LCD TVs, LED televisions are smaller and more energy-efficient.  They are also thinner—just a third of the thickness of similarly-sized standard 110-220 volts LCD TVs, and about half the weight. What’s more, LED TVs produce a more colorful and vibrant images with greater dynamic contrast. What’s more, LED TVs are made with parts that are ‘greener’ and more environmentally friendly.
